Rolf Eyewear wins Red Dot Aards for eco-conscious eyewear
Austrian eyewear pioneer Rolf Eyewear is celebrating a remarkable achievement this season, securing a double win at the Red Dot Award 2025.
The brand was honored in both the Product Design and the Sustainable Design meta-category for its Wire Collection, an avant-garde line of frames that merges aesthetics, technical innovation, and deep environmental commitment.
Pushing design and sustainability forward
By winning the Red Dot Award 2025 for sustainable innovation in eyewear, Rolf Eyewear reinforces its position at the cutting edge of independent eyewear. The Wire Collection captivated the international Red Dot Award 2025 jury with its exceptional design quality and a holistic sustainability approach that challenges conventional eyewear production and redefines what is possible in the realm of sustainable luxury.
These featherlight frames are crafted from an innovative plant-based powder, which is locally processed and shaped through advanced 3D printing. The result is a collection of screwless frames characterized by a radical minimalist design, elegant technical detailing, and a significantly reduced carbon footprint. The Wire Collection perfectly embodies the vision of both eco-conscious eyewear and sustainable eyewear, making it a model of responsible product design.
Each frame is equipped with Rolf Eyewear’s patented Flexlock hinge, delivering a unique combination of flexibility and durability that ensures lasting wear, even under demanding everyday use and diverse conditions. Importantly, this innovation is backed by a production process that runs entirely on 100% green electricity, takes place in Rolf Eyewear’s Tyrolean headquarters, and adheres to an ethos of short, local supply chains.
“This double recognition at the Red Dot Award 2025 reaffirms our commitment to combining great design with real responsibility,” Rolf Eyewear stated. “It’s not only an acknowledgment of our work, but also an incentive to continue our journey — with curiosity, innovation, and respect for people and nature.”
With the Wire Collection, Rolf Eyewear once again proves that technical sophistication, eco-conscious innovation, and sustainable eyewear can co-exist, setting a powerful example for the future of independent eyewear.
About Rolf Eyewear
Rolf is an Austrian eyewear brand known for its pioneering approach to natural materials, sustainable design, and in-house craftsmanship. Based in the Tyrolean Alps, Rolf has earned a global reputation for blending innovation with a deep respect for nature and tradition.
What sets Rolf Spectacles apart is its mastery in working with natural materials, like wood, stone, bean-based biopolymers, and titanium, all without the use of screws or metal hinges.
Each frame is designed, produced, and hand-finished in-house, reflecting the brand’s pursuit of sustainability, durability, and functional beauty.
With its patented hinge systems and award-winning designs, Rolf challenges conventional eyewear standards by proving that eco-conscious can also mean high-tech and high style. It’s eyewear for those who value authenticity, craftsmanship, and a lighter footprint on the planet.
